

Las traducciones son generadas a través de traducción automática. En caso de conflicto entre la traducción y la version original de inglés, prevalecerá la version en inglés.

# Pasar archivos a estado WORM
<a name="worm-state"></a>

En esta sección se explica cómo hacer la transición de los archivos a un estado de escritura única y lectura múltiple (WORM). También se describe el modo añadir volúmenes, que es una forma de escribir datos de forma incremental en archivos protegidos por WORM. 

## Confirmación automática
<a name="worm-state-autocommit"></a>

Puede usar la confirmación automática para realizar la transición de archivos a WORM si no se han modificado durante el período que usted especifique. Puedes activar la confirmación automática con la FSx consola de Amazon AWS CLI, la API de Amazon y las FSx API ONTAP CLI y REST. 

Puede especificar un período de confirmación automática de entre cinco minutos y 10 años. La siguiente tabla enumera los rangos específicos que se admiten. 


****  

| Unidad | Valor | 
| --- | --- | 
|  Minutos  |  5 a 65 535  | 
|  Horas  |  1 a 65 535  | 
|  Días  |  1 a 3650  | 
|  Meses  |  1 a 120  | 
|  Años  |  1 a 10  | 

Para activar la confirmación automática con la FSx API de Amazon, utilízala `AutocommitPeriod` en. [https://docs.aws.amazon.com/fsx/latest/APIReference/API_CreateSnaplockConfiguration.html](https://docs.aws.amazon.com/fsx/latest/APIReference/API_CreateSnaplockConfiguration.html) En la FSx consola de Amazon, para **Autocommit**, selecciona **Enabled**. En **Periodo de confirmación automática**, ingrese un valor y seleccione la **Unidad de confirmación automática** correspondiente. 

Puede especificar un valor entre 5 minutos y 10 años.

## Modo añadir volumen
<a name="worm-state-append"></a>

No puede modificar los datos existentes en un archivo protegido por WORM. Sin embargo, SnapLock le permite mantener la protección de los datos existentes mediante archivos que se pueden añadir a WORM. Por ejemplo, puede generar archivos de registro o conservar los datos de transmisión de audio o vídeo y, al mismo tiempo, escribir los datos en ellos de forma incremental. Puede activar o desactivar el modo de adición de volumen con la FSx consola de Amazon, la API de Amazon y AWS CLI las FSx API ONTAP CLI y REST. 

**Requisitos para actualizar el modo añadir volúmenes**
+ El volumen SnapLock debe estar desmontado.
+ El volumen SnapLock debe estar vacío de copias instantáneas y datos de usuario. 

 

Para activar el modo de adición de volumen con la FSx API de Amazon, `VolumeAppendModeEnabled` utilízalo en. [https://docs.aws.amazon.com/fsx/latest/APIReference/API_CreateSnaplockConfiguration.html](https://docs.aws.amazon.com/fsx/latest/APIReference/API_CreateSnaplockConfiguration.html) En la FSx consola de Amazon, en el **modo de adición de volúmenes**, selecciona **Enabled**. 

## Retención basada en eventos (EBR)
<a name="worm-state-ebr"></a>

Puede usar la retención basada en eventos (EBR) para crear políticas personalizadas con los periodos de retención asociados. Por ejemplo, puede hacer la transición de todos los archivos de una ruta específica a WORM y establecer el período de retención en un año con los comandos `snaplock event-retention policy create` y `snaplock event-retention apply`. Cuando utilice EBR, debe especificar un volumen, directorio o archivo. El periodo de retención que seleccione al crear la política de EBR se aplica a todos los archivos de la ruta especificada. 

EBR es compatible con la CLI ONTAP y la API de REST. 

**nota**  
ONTAPno admite EBR con FlexGroup volúmenes.

En los siguientes procedimientos se explica cómo crear, aplicar, modificar y eliminar una política de EBR. Debe ser administrador SnapLock (tener la el rol `vsadmin-snaplock`) para completar estas tareas en la CLI ONTAP. Para obtener más información, consulte [Administrador de SnapLock](how-snaplock-works.md#snaplock-admin). 

### Crear una política EBR en la CLI de ONTAP
<a name="create-ebr-ontap-cli"></a>

**Para crear una política EBR en la CLI de ONTAP**
+ Ejecute el comando siguiente. Sustituya *p1* y *"10 years"* con su propia información. 

  ```
  vs1::> snaplock event-retention policy create -name p1 -retention-period "10 years"
  ```

### Aplicar una política de EBR en la CLI de ONTAP
<a name="apply-ebr-ontap-cli"></a>

**Para aplicar una política de EBR en la CLI ONTAP**
+ Ejecute el comando siguiente. Sustituya *p1* y *slc* con su propia información. Puede agregar una ruta después de la barra diagonal (/) si desea especificar una ruta concreta para la política de EBR. De lo contrario, este comando aplica la política EBR a todos los archivos del volumen. 

  ```
  vs1::> snaplock event-retention apply -policy-name p1 -volume slc -path /
  ```

### Modificar una política de EBR en la CLI de ONTAP
<a name="modify-ebr-ontap-cli"></a>

**Para modificar una política de EBR en la CLI de ONTAP**
+ Ejecute el comando siguiente. Sustituya *p1* y *"5 years"* con su propia información. 

  ```
  vs1::> snaplock event-retention policy modify -name p1 -retention-period "5 years"
  ```

### Eliminar una política de EBR en la CLI de ONTAP
<a name="delete-ebr-ontap-cli"></a>

**Para eliminar una política de EBR en la CLI de ONTAP**
+ Ejecute el comando siguiente. *p1*Sustitúyalo por tu propia información. 

  ```
  vs1::> snaplock event-retention policy delete -name p1
  ```

Comandos relacionados en el *Centro de documentación NetApp*:
+ [snaplock event-retention abort](https://docs.netapp.com/us-en/ontap-cli-9121/snaplock-event-retention-abort.html)
+ [snaplock event-retention show-vservers](https://docs.netapp.com/us-en/ontap-cli-9121/snaplock-event-retention-show-vservers.html)
+ [snaplock event-retention show](https://docs.netapp.com/us-en/ontap-cli-9121/snaplock-event-retention-show.html)
+ [snaplock event-retention policy show](https://docs.netapp.com/us-en/ontap-cli-9121/snaplock-event-retention-policy-show.html)

## Retención legal
<a name="worm-state-legal-hold"></a>

Puede retener archivos WORM durante un periodo de tiempo indefinido utilizando la Retención legal. Por lo general, la retención legal se utiliza con fines de litigio. Un archivo WORM que esté sujeto a una Retención legal no se puede eliminar hasta que se levante la Retención legal. 

La CLI ONTAP y la API de REST admiten la Retención legal. 

**nota**  
ONTAPno admite la retención legal de FlexGroup volúmenes.

En los siguientes procedimientos se explica cómo iniciar y finalizar una Retención legal. Debe ser administrador SnapLock (tener la el rol `vsadmin-snaplock`) para completar estas tareas en la CLI ONTAP. Para obtener más información, consulte [Administrador de SnapLock](how-snaplock-works.md#snaplock-admin). 

### Iniciar una Retención legal de un archivo en un volumen de Conformidad de SnapLock con la CLI de ONTAP
<a name="start-legal-hold-ontap-cli"></a>

**Para iniciar una Retención legal de un archivo de un volumen de Conformidad de SnapLock con la CLI de ONTAP**
+ Ejecute el comando siguiente. Reemplace *litigation1**slc\$1vol1*, y *file1* con su propia información. 

  ```
  vs1::> snaplock legal-hold begin -litigation-name litigation1 -volume slc_vol1 -path /file1
  ```

### Iniciar una Retención legal de todos los archivos de un volumen de Conformidad de SnapLock con la CLI de ONTAP
<a name="start-legal-hold-all-files-ontap-cli"></a>

**Para iniciar una Retención legal de todos los archivos de un volumen de Conformidad de SnapLock con la CLI de ONTAP**
+ Ejecute el comando siguiente. Sustituya *litigation1* y *slc\$1vol1* con su propia información. 

  ```
  vs1::> snaplock legal-hold begin -litigation-name litigation1 -volume slc_vol1 -path /
  ```

### Poner fin a una Retención legal de un archivo de un volumen de Conformidad de SnapLock con la CLI de ONTAP
<a name="end-legal-hold-ontap-cli"></a>

**Para poner fin a una Retención legal de un archivo de un volumen de Conformidad de SnapLock con la CLI de ONTAP**
+ Ejecute el comando siguiente. Reemplace *litigation1**slc\$1vol1*, y *file1* con su propia información. 

  ```
  vs1::> snaplock legal-hold end -litigation-name litigation1 -volume slc_vol1 -path /file1
  ```
**nota**  
Le recomendamos que supervise el `-operation-status` con el comando `snaplock legal-hold show` cuando emita una Retención legal para asegurarse de que no falla. 

### Poner fin a una Retención legal de todos los archivos de un volumen de Conformidad de SnapLock con la CLI de ONTAP
<a name="end-legal-hold-all-files-ontap-cli"></a>

**Para poner fin a una Retención legal de todos los archivos de un volumen de Conformidad de SnapLock con la CLI de ONTAP**
+ Ejecute el comando siguiente. Sustituya *litigation1* y *slc\$1vol1* con su propia información. 

  ```
  vs1::> snaplock legal-hold end -litigation-name litigation1 -volume slc_vol1 -path /
  ```
**nota**  
Le recomendamos que supervise el `-operation-status` con el comando `snaplock legal-hold show` cuando emita una Retención legal para asegurarse de que no falla. 

 Comandos relacionados en el *Centro de documentación NetApp*:
+ [snaplock legal-hold abort](https://docs.netapp.com/us-en/ontap-cli-9121/snaplock-legal-hold-abort.html)
+ [snaplock legal-hold dump-files](https://docs.netapp.com/us-en/ontap-cli-9121/snaplock-legal-hold-dump-files.html)
+ [snaplock legal-hold dump-litigations](https://docs.netapp.com/us-en/ontap-cli-9121/snaplock-legal-hold-dump-litigations.html)
+ [snaplock legal-hold show](https://docs.netapp.com/us-en/ontap-cli-9121/snaplock-legal-hold-show.html)